Dodge Ram 1500 Towing Capacity

The Dodge Ram 1500 has a maximum towing capacity of 12,750 pounds with a 5.7 L Hemi V8 engine.

The Dodge Ram 1500’s towing capacity ranges from 7,730 to 12,750 pounds, depending on whether you’re driving a 1500 sporting a 3.6 L PentaStar V6 engine or the powerful 5.7 L Hemi V8 engine with eTorque. 
If you’re the type that likes to haul heavy loads across dusty trails or commercial sites (or you’re just a serious camper), you’ll need to know your vehicle’s towing capacity. Pickups are built with towing in mind, but your truck’s engine, transmission, size, and other features will determine how big of a load you’re able to tow.

How much can a Dodge Ram 1500 tow?

Base towing capacity: 7,730 pounds
Maximum towing capacity: 12,750 pounds
Engines: 3.0 L EcoDiesel V6 (260 hp), 3.6 L PentaStar V6 with eTorque (305 hp), 5.7 L Hemi V8 (395 hp), or 5.7 L Hemi V8 with eTorque (395 hp)
The Dodge Ram 1500 is the best of both worlds—a truck capable of towing significant payloads while still operating as a perfectly functional daily vehicle. It has a more luxurious feel and boasts a smoother, more refined ride than its rivals.
The base 3.6 PentaStar engine can tow 7,730 pounds, but your towing capacity will go up significantly if electing for the 3.0 L EcoDiesel, which can tow 12,560 pounds. Upgrading to the 5.7 L Hemi will let you haul even more—12,750 pounds.

How to calculate the towing capacity you need

If you’re wondering how much you can tow with your Dodge Ram 1500, you’re not alone! Do remember to keep the gross weight of your payload lower than your maximum towing capacity. Hitching a full 7,730 pounds to your 3.6 L Pentastar V6 is not a good idea.
While exact weight may differ, here’s what you can expect to safely tow with your Dodge Ram 1500:
With 3.6 L Pentastar V6 with eTorque (7,730-lb. capacity)
  • Pop-up camper (2,800 to 4,300 lbs.) 
  • Some utility trailers (up to 5,000 lbs.)
With a 5.7 L Hemi V8 with eTorque (12,750-lb. capacity)
  • 37-foot camper van (7,757 lbs.)
  • Sailboats (up to 8,880 lbs.)
Whether your towing needs revolve around taking the boat to the lake or are directed towards more commercial or industrial uses, the Dodge Ram 1500 can fit the bill. While your towing capacity will be limited depending on the type of engine you choose, you’ll definitely be able to meet most needs.
Always remember that every payload is different—check your truck’s towing capacity and the total weight of your truck and hitch when fully loaded. Remember to account for the weight of passengers and cargo, too. 

How to increase towing capacity

If you want to increase your Dodge Ram’s towing capacity, you can try the following:
  • Add a weight-distribution hitch to limit sway and take pressure off your suspension
  • Replace your brake pads and rotors to help handle heavier loads
  • Think about adding stronger axles, such as RV axles
Do know that some upgrades can actually lower your towing capacity. For instance, swapping out the Ram’s standard wheels for larger, aftermarket ones can apply more pressure to your engine and reduce your truck’s overall towing power.
